The Hagia Sophia was my favorite today. It is the 4th biggest cathedral in the world. It was also turned into a mosque and is now a museum. It was pretty incredible. I felt smaller than normal as I looked up at the dome. It is 100 feet in diameter. It is not exactly circular because of structural issues. The art has been covered by plaster by they are working on restoring it. The mere size of Hagia Sophia is breathtaking!

Carpet shopping was next on the agenda. Before we could buy we were well educated on how carpets are made and hot to gage the value of them. These carpets are made of cotton, wool, or silk. The number of knots, the workmanship, and the type of fiber all determine the price. I saw a carpet that took someone two years to make. Incredible.
